Овај водич ће објаснити како да проверите активне и неактивне сесије:
Како проверити активне и неактивне сесије у Орацле бази података?
Да бисте проверили активне и неактивне сесије у Орацле-у, пријавите се у базу података као администратор. За ову објаву се користи СКЛ програмер, тако да успоставите везу или се пријавите у складу са тим.
Како проверити активне и неактивне сесије користећи в$сессион?
„ в$сессион ” пружа информације о сесијама само за тренутну инстанцу. „ СЕЛЕЦТ ” изјава са „ в$сессион ” се може користити за проверу активних и неактивних сесија.
Проверите активне сесије користећи в$сессион
„ ГДЕ ” клаузула се може користити за примену филтера за проверу активних сесија док се користи в$сессион сто. Упит је дат у наставку:
СЕЛЕЦТ * ФРОМ в$сессион ВХЕРЕ СТАТУС = 'АКТИВНО';
Горњи упит ће приказати само редове у којима је вредност у „ СТАТУС ” колона је “ АКТИВНО ”.
Излаз
Излаз је приказао активне сесије.
Проверите неактивне сесије користећи в$сессион
„ ГДЕ ” клаузула се може користити за примену филтера за проверу неактивних сесија помоћу в$сессион . Упит је дат у наставку:
СЕЛЕЦТ * ФРОМ в$сессион ВХЕРЕ СТАТУС = 'НЕАКТИВНО';Горњи упит ће приказати само оне сесије које су тренутно „ НЕАКТИВНО ”.
Излаз
Излаз је показао да нема неактивне сесије.
Како проверити активне и неактивне сесије користећи гв$сессион?
„ гв$сессион ” пружа информације о сесијама за све инстанце. „ СЕЛЕЦТ ” изјава са „ гв$сессион ” се може користити за приказ информација о сесијама. „ ГДЕ ” ће се користити за филтрирање активних и неактивних сесија.
Проверите активне сесије користећи гв$сессион
Да бисте проверили активну сесију, филтрирајте податке гв$сессион табелу, одабиром само редова у којима је вредност у „ СТАТУС ” колона је “ АКТИВНО ”. Упит је дат у наставку:
СЕЛЕЦТ * ФРОМ гв$сессион ВХЕРЕ СТАТУС='АКТИВНО'; Излаз
Излаз је показао да су активне сесије филтриране.
Проверите неактивне сесије користећи гв$сессион
„ ГДЕ ” клаузула се може користити за одабир само редова у којима је вредност у „ СТАТУС ” колона је “ НЕАКТИВНО ” у гв$сессион сто. Упит је дат у наставку:
СЕЛЕЦТ * ФРОМ гв$сессион ВХЕРЕ СТАТУС='НЕАКТИВНО'; Излаз
Излаз је показао да нема неактивне сесије.
Како проверити активне и неактивне сесије одређеног корисника?
У Орацле бази података, активне и неактивне сесије одређеног корисника могу се проверити навођењем корисничког имена у клаузули ВХЕРЕ.
Проверите активне сесије одређеног корисника
Упит за проверу активне сесије одређеног корисника је дат у наставку:
СЕЛЕЦТ * ФРОМ в$сессион ВХЕРЕ СТАТУС = 'АКТИВНО' И СЦХЕМАНАМЕ = 'СИС';У горњем упиту, корисничко име (име шеме) је „ СИС ”.
Излаз
Излаз приказује активну сесију за „ СИС ” корисник.
Проверите неактивне сесије одређеног корисника
Да бисте проверили неактивну сесију одређеног корисника, откуцајте следећи упит:
СЕЛЕЦТ * ФРОМ в$сессион ВХЕРЕ СТАТУС = 'НЕАКТИВНО' И СЦХЕМАНАМЕ = 'СИС'; Излаз
Снимак екрана је показао да нема неактивне сесије „ СИС ” корисник.
Закључак
Активне и неактивне сесије у Орацле-у могу се проверити коришћењем „ в$сессион ” или “ гв$сессион ” табела са „ СЕЛЕЦТ ' изјава. Да бисте филтрирали активне или неактивне сесије, „ ГДЕ “ клаузула се може користити са “ СТАТУС ” колона. Ако желите да проверите активне или неактивне сесије за одређеног корисника, можете навести корисничко име у клаузули ВХЕРЕ. Овај текст је показао практичан водич о томе како да проверите активне и неактивне сесије у Орацле бази података.